Greetings,

Today at work (Edgewood Area of APG) I was stuck down range on a stand by
for nearly four hours. The sky was full of raptors. I was able to ID NINE
different species of raptors, including the vultures.  Below is a list of
those raptors and other interesting birds of the day.  Most notable though
was a small (9) kettle of Broad-winged Hawks and my season's first Caspian
Terns and Rough-winged Swallows.!

Black Vulture (3)
Turkey Vulture (scores)
Bald Eagle (4)
Osprey (28!)
Sharp-shinned Hawk (3)
Broad-winged Hawk (15)
Red-tailed Hawk (1)
Kestrel (3)
Merlin (2)
Caspian Tern (2)
Northern Rough-winged Swallow (5)
Tree Swallow (100+)
Turkey (7)
